Influenced by Central Asian history and cooler climates, North Indian cuisine relies heavily on wheat flatbreads ( naan , roti ) and dairy. Gravies are rich, often thickened with yogurt, cream, cashew paste, and clarified butter ( ghee ). Signature dishes like Biryani , Butter Chicken , and slow-cooked Dal Makhani define this region. Southern India thrives on a tropical climate, making rice the undisputed king. The flavors are sharp, tangy, and fiery, driven by tamarind, curry leaves, and fresh coconut. Traditionally, Indians eat with their right hand. This lifestyle practice is rooted in sensory connection. Touching the food creates a tactile link, signaling the stomach to release digestive enzymes before the food even reaches the mouth. West India offers stark contrasts. The arid states of Rajasthan and Gujarat rely heavily on lentils, chickpea flour ( besan ), and pickles to substitute for the historic lack of fresh vegetables. The saree is a long piece of fabric, usually around 5-9 yards, that is draped around the body in various styles to create a stunning and elegant outfit. Sarees have been a cornerstone of Indian and South Asian fashion for centuries, with a rich history and cultural significance. They are often worn on special occasions, such as weddings, festivals, and formal events, but are also a popular choice for everyday wear.
